Why Some Homes Are Selling Faster Than Others Right Now

Lonestar Living Team | April 23, 2026

As the North Texas market continues to move, we're seeing a clear pattern in what helps certain homes stand out and attract strong interest early on. While every property is unique, there are a few consistent factors that tend to drive quicker activity and stronger buyer response. Understanding what’s working right now can give both buyers and sellers a better sense of how to navigate the market with confidence.

It Starts With Pricing

In today’s market, pricing isn’t just important, it’s everything.

Homes that are priced correctly from day one tend to attract more attention, more showings, and often stronger offers. Buyers are paying close attention and comparing options carefully. When a home is priced too high, even slightly, it can cause buyers to scroll past or hesitate to schedule a showing.

Homes that are aligned with current market conditions tend to build momentum right away.

First Impressions Matter

Buyers are forming opinions before they ever step through the front door.

From listing photos to curb appeal, the homes that stand out online are the ones getting the most traffic. Clean, well-staged spaces with good lighting and a thoughtful presentation consistently perform better.

Even small updates like fresh paint, decluttering, or simple landscaping can have a noticeable impact on how quickly a home sells.

Condition and Updates Play a Big Role

Move-in ready homes continue to have an advantage.

Many buyers are looking for homes that feel updated and well cared for, especially with the cost and time that renovations can require. Homes with modern finishes, neutral tones, and well-maintained systems tend to move faster than those that need more work.

That said, homes that need updates can still sell successfully. It just comes down to having the right strategy in place.

Location Still Carries Weight

You’ve heard it before, and it still holds true. Location matters.

Homes in sought-after areas like McKinney, Frisco, and Prosper continue to see strong demand, especially when they are close to schools, parks, shopping, and major roadways.

Even within the same neighborhood, factors like lot placement, traffic, and proximity to amenities can influence how quickly a home sells.

Marketing Makes a Difference

It’s not just about putting a home on the market. It’s about how it is presented.

Professional photography, video, and a strong marketing plan help create exposure and drive interest early on. Homes that generate the most attention in the first week are often the ones that sell the fastest.

That early activity plays a big role in the overall success of a listing.

Buyer Behavior Is Always Shifting

Buyer activity changes with the season, interest rates, and overall market confidence.

Right now, many buyers are being more intentional with their decisions. They are taking time to compare options and waiting for the right fit. When a home checks the right boxes, they are ready to move forward.

That is why some homes sell quickly while others take longer. It often comes down to how well the home matches what buyers are looking for at that moment.

What This Means for You

Homes that sell quickly today tend to have a few things in common. They are priced correctly, show well, are in good condition, and are marketed effectively.

For sellers, understanding these factors can help you position your home to stand out from the start. For buyers, it gives you a clearer picture of why some homes move quickly and how to recognize a strong opportunity when you see one.
